Guiguzi's zodiac fortune - telling is based on the traditional Chinese zodiac system, which consists of twelve animals representing different years. Each zodiac sign is believed to have distinct characteristics and is associated with certain fortunes and destinies.
To start the fortune - telling process, one needs to know their exact birth year according to the Chinese lunar calendar. This is crucial because it determines the corresponding zodiac sign. For example, if someone was born in 1990, their Chinese zodiac sign is the Horse.
Once the zodiac sign is identified, the next step is to analyze the characteristics and fortune predictions associated with that sign. According to Guiguzi's teachings, each zodiac sign has unique personality traits. The Rat, for instance, is considered intelligent, adaptable, and resourceful. The Ox is known for its hard - working, honest, and reliable nature.
When it comes to fortune prediction, Guiguzi's program takes into account different aspects such as career, love, and health. For career, some zodiac signs may be more likely to succeed in business, while others may be better suited for artistic or academic pursuits. In terms of love, certain signs are believed to be more compatible with each other. For example, the Dragon and the Rooster are often considered a good match.
However, it's important to note that Guiguzi's zodiac fortune - telling is not a scientific method. It is more of a cultural and traditional practice that reflects the wisdom and beliefs of ancient Chinese people. It can be seen as a form of self - reflection and a way to gain insights into one's potential and challenges.
